What the change groups mean
- FM
- From — a rapid, permanent change to the conditions that follow.
- BECMG
- Becoming — a gradual change over the stated window.
What the categories mean
- VFR
- Visual flight rules — ceiling above 3,000 ft and visibility greater than 5 SM.
- MVFR
- Marginal VFR — ceiling 1,000 to 3,000 ft and/or visibility 3 to 5 SM.
- IFR
- Instrument flight rules — ceiling 500 to 999 ft and/or visibility 1 to less than 3 SM.

How far ahead does a TAF forecast?
A TAF covers a 24-hour period at most airports and 30 hours at larger ones, issued four times a day at 0000Z, 0600Z, 1200Z and 1800Z. It describes conditions within roughly 5 statute miles of the airport, not the surrounding area.
What do FM, BECMG and TEMPO mean?
FM (from) marks a rapid, permanent change at the stated time. BECMG (becoming) marks a gradual change over the stated window. TEMPO marks conditions expected for less than half the period, in spells of under an hour each. PROB30 and PROB40 give the probability of the conditions that follow.
